Gold Trommel Wash Plant: Efficient Solution for Alluvial Gold Processing

A gold trommel wash plant is a rotating cylindrical sieve designed to separate gold-bearing gravels efficiently. Its modular design integrates scrubbing, screening, and concentration functions, making it ideal for placer mining operations.

Core Components & Working Principle

1. Trommel Screen: A perforated rotating drum (typically 3–10m long, Ø1.5–3m) classifies materials by size.
2. Scrubbing System: High-pressure water jets break clay-bound aggregates.
3. Sluice Box/Sluice Matting: Captures gold particles via gravity separation.
4. Feed Hopper & Conveyor: Ensures steady material flow (capacity: 50–300 TPH).

FAQ

Q: What’s the optimal feed size?
A: ≤100mm for efficient screening and gold recovery.

Q: How to maintain trommel longevity?
A: Regularly inspect screen wear and bearing lubrication intervals (every 500 hours).

Engineering Case

A Ghana-based operation deployed a 100 TPH trommel plant with Ø2m drum and rubber-lined sluice mats, achieving 92% gold recovery from alluvial deposits with <0.5mm gold particles. The system reduced manual panning labor by 70%.

For hard rock applications, pair the trommel with a jaw crusher or cone crusher upstream to pre-process ore. Downstream, centrifugal concentrators may enhance fine gold recovery (>325 mesh).
